I was very pleased with Dr. Hilinksi's suggestions at my consultation. He suggested electrocautery for a small burst blood vessel on my upper chest, and the "shave" technique for two moles under my eye. The end results are great and I will be coming back for more mole removals in the future. The entire staff is very friendly and Dr. Hilinski seems to really care about getting the perfect result

Regarding the $350 figure above, what did that pay for? Consultation/first office visit only, or everything, including consultation/first office visit+2 mole shaves+electrocautery for your small burst blood vessel?
May 7, 2016
Oops sorry I never saw this until just now, but in case anyone else comes upon this, the $350 included everything: consultation, electrocautery, mole shave, and 2 or 3 follow up visits to check the progress of the end result. I think I only had 1 mole shaved though, not 2 like my review says. I had a sunspot in the same area under my eye where the mole was removed, but he said it would be best for me to try over the counter hydroquinone cream to fade it or to look into laser treatment somewhere (he doesn't do lasers).
